Other Computer & Information Sciences is the 256th most popular major in the country with 1,326 degrees awarded in 2019-2020. In 2017-2018, other computer and information sciences graduates who were awarded their degree in 2015-2017, earned an average of $42,177 and had an average of $20,758 in loans still to pay off.

At the doctor’s degree level specifically, there were 15 other computer and information sciences graduates with average earnings and debt of $72,680 and $116,043 respectively.

Louisiana Tech University

Ruston, Louisiana
#1 in overall quality

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Louisiana Tech University. It ranked #1 on our 2022 Best Value Other Computer Science Schools for a Doctorate list. This fairly large school is located in Ruston, Louisiana, and it awarded 7 doctorate’s other computer science degrees in 2019-2020.

Louisiana Tech did well in our major quality rankings, too. It placed #1 on our “Best Other Computer & Information Sciences Doctor’s Degree Schools” list. Although you might pay more or less depending on your area of study, average graduate tuition and fees at Louisiana Tech University are $12,690.

University of Southern Mississippi

Hattiesburg, Mississippi
#1 in overall quality

Out of the 1 schools in the Best Value Other Computer Science Schools for a Doctorate that were part of this year’s ranking, University of Southern Mississippi landed the #1 spot on the list. University of Southern Mississippi is a fairly large school located in Hattiesburg, Mississippi that handed out 3 doctorate’s other computer science degrees in 2019-2020.

As a testament to the quality of education offered at Southern Miss, the school also landed the #1 spot in our “Best Other Computer & Information Sciences Doctor’s Degree Schools” ranking. Although you might pay more or less depending on your area of study, average graduate tuition and fees at Southern Miss are $10,896.
